gpt4 book ai didi

vim - 在 Vim 中保存常用的正则表达式模式?

转载 作者:行者123 更新时间:2023-12-03 11:41:36 25 4
gpt4 key购买 nike

有没有一种简单的方法来保存常用的正则表达式模式,以便我可以在不同的文件之间重用它?我查看了许多日志文件,并且总是需要创建一个稍微复杂的正则表达式(这不是火箭科学,但重新输入很痛苦)来查找错误,所以最好有一种方法来记忆它而不必将它保存在文本中文件并每次将其粘贴到搜索参数中。

最佳答案

放:

source ~/.regexlist.vim

进入你的 vimrc。

进行搜索。决定你可能想再次使用那个。按字面意思输入:
:sp ~/.regexlist.vim<CR>
olet MyRegExName = '<C-R>/'<ESC>
:w<CR>
:so %<CR>
:q<CR>

在哪里 <C-R>是 CtrlR, <CR>是 ENTER 和 <ESC>是电调。

下次您想使用它时:
/<C-R>=MyRegExName<CR><CR>

Ctrl-R 是你的 friend ! Ctrl-R 后跟/拉起最后一次搜索。 Ctrl-R 后跟 = 允许您输入表达式。

关于vim - 在 Vim 中保存常用的正则表达式模式?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/2201174/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com